The JobSearch WP Job Board plugin for WordPress is vulnerable to arbitrary file uploads due to missing file type validation in the jobsearch_location_load_excel_file_callback() function in all versions up to, and including, 2.6.7. This makes it possible for unauthenticated attackers to upload arbitrary files on the affected site's server which may make remote code execution possible.
The JobSearch WP Job Board plugin for WordPress is vulnerable to arbitrary file uploads due to missing file type validation in the jobsearch_wp_handle_upload() function in all versions up to, and including, 2.6.7. This makes it possible for authenticated attackers, with subscriber-level access and above, to upload arbitrary files on the affected site's server which may make remote code execution possible.

The JobSearch WP Job Board plugin for WordPress is vulnerable to authorization bypass due to a missing capability check on the jobsearch_add_job_import_schedule_call() function in versions up to, and including, 1.8.1. This makes it possible for authenticated attackers to add and/or modify schedule calls.
The JobSearch WP Job Board plugin for WordPress is vulnerable to authorization bypass due to a missing capability check on the jobsearch_job_integrations_settin_save AJAX action in versions up to, and including, 1.8.1. This makes it possible for authenticated attackers to update arbitrary options on the site.
The JobSearch WP Job Board plugin for WordPress is vulnerable to authorization bypass due to a missing capability check on the save_locsettings function in versions up to, and including, 1.8.1. This makes it possible for unauthenticated attackers to change the settings of the plugin.

The WP JobSearch WordPress plugin before 1.7.4 did not sanitise or escape multiple of its parameters from the my-resume page before outputting them in the page, allowing low privilege users to use JavaScript payloads in them and leading to a Stored Cross-Site Scripting issue
